Purpose

To consider approving the alignment and
re-commissioning of our existing recycling infrastructure contracts
- the Waste Transfer Station and our Household Waste Recycling
Centres.

Content

1.         That the
public and press be excluded from the meeting by virtue of
Paragraph 3 (Information relating to the Financial or Business
Affairs of the Authority) of Part I of Schedule 12A of the Local
Government Act 1972, in order that the meeting may consider exempt
Annexes B and C to the report.

2.         That the
Recycling Infrastructure Services Commissioning Plan, attached at
Annex A to the report, be approved.

3.         That the
award of an extension of the operation and management of the
materials recycling facility contract, up to and including 31 March
2028, be approved, subject to finalising the deed of variation to the contract
materially on the same terms of scope of services and therefore the
nature of the contract will remain unaltered.

4.         That the
award of an extension of the Household
Waste Recycling Centres
contract, up to
and including 31 March 2028, subject to finalising the contract to extend by one month, be
approved.

5.         That the
resource allocation and spend approval of £0.250m in the
2024/25 Capital Programme, be
approved.
